Todo se puede aprender
...si se quiere.
Home » , , » Implementando Algoritmos de Grafos - Ejemplos en C++

Implementando Algoritmos de Grafos - Ejemplos en C++

Hoy vamos a entregar a pedido de mis lectores implementacion de grafos en C++. Mi anterior post de Algoritmos de Búsqueda en Anchura (BFS) y Búsqueda en Profundidad (DFS) tuvo muchos seguidores el cual se contactaron para pedirme ejemplos de códigos en C++ implementando estos algoritmos.

A continuación les dejo un listado de con los códigos (.cpp) y la problemática presentada. Están subidos al drive ( Por lo tanto tienen Descarga Directa para Desktop y Mobile ).
Todos los comentarios del código están en español para que no tengan mayores complicaciones:



  1. Algoritmo BFS.
  2. Algoritmo DFS.
  3. Algoritmo DFS usando recursion.
  4. Algoritmo DFS usando Stack.
  5. Algoritmo de Bellman-Ford.
  6. Algoritmo Dijkstra.
  7. Algoritmo Kruskal.
  8. BFS Ejemplo - Problemática Saliente del Laberinto.
  9. DFS Ejemplo - Problemática Conectividad.
  10. DFS Ejemplo - Problemática Dominios.
También les voy a dejar dos videos muy buenos donde se trata en modo de ejemplo en C++ los Grafos Dinámicos BFS y DFS.

Grafo Dinámico de Recorrido de Anchura (BFS)


Grafo Dinámico de Recorrido de Profundidad (DFS)


Espero que les haya sido de utilidad, no se olviden de comentar y hacerme pedidos para subir los próximos temas.